Key facts
- Median U.S. household income rose to a record $87,460 in 2025, surpassing the 2019 peak of $85,320.[CBS News · ABC News]
- Inflation-adjusted income grew roughly 2.5% between 2019 and 2025, compared to 19% growth between 2013 and 2019.[CBS News · ABC News]
- Women's paychecks increased by 3.2% in 2025 while men's declined slightly, narrowing the wage gap so women earned nearly 84 cents for every dollar men earned.[CBS News · ABC News]
- The official U.S. poverty rate dropped by 0.5 percentage points to 10.2% in 2025.[CBS News]
- Income for the top 10% of earners increased by 1.7% to $261,300, while income for the bottom 10% slightly declined to just over $20,000.[CBS News]
